This recipe produced tough, bland corncakes - not very tasty. The cornmeal to all purpose flour ratio was too high (ie, the recipe needs less cornmeal and more flour, and there was too little salt and sugar. The recipe also needs a better leavening agent like baking POWDER or egg.
